source: projects/specs/trunk/l/lightdm-gtk/lightdm-gtk-vl.spec @ 9552

Revision 9552, 1.9 KB checked in by Takemikaduchi, 9 years ago (diff)

task-xorg-x11: fix BTS:2913
others: new upstream release

Line 
1Summary: Reference GTK+ greeter for LightDM
2Name: lightdm-gtk
3Version: 1.8.5
4Release: 3%{?_dist_release}
5License: GPL3
6Group: User Interface/X
7URL: https://launchpad.net/lightdm-gtk-greeter/
8
9Source: https://launchpad.net/%{name}-greeter/1.8/%{version}/+download/%{name}-greeter-%{version}.tar.gz
10
11# for Vine Linux
12Patch1000: lightdm-gtk-greeter-1.8.5-vine.patch
13Patch1001: lightdm-gtk-greeter-1.8.5-ja.po.patch
14Patch1002: lightdm-gtk-greeter-1.8.5-background.patch
15
16Requires: lightdm
17Requires: gnome-icon-theme
18Requires: gtk2-engines
19
20BuildRequires: gtk2-devel
21BuildRequires: lightdm-gobject-devel
22BuildRequires: libX11-devel
23
24Provides: lightdm-greeter
25
26Vendor: Project Vine
27Distribution: Vine Linux
28Packager: Takemikaduchi
29
30
31%description
32%{summary}
33
34
35%prep
36%setup -q -n %{name}-greeter-%{version}
37%patch1000 -p1 -b .vine
38%patch1001 -p1 -b .vine
39%patch1002 -p1 -b .vine
40
41%build
42%configure \
43                --with-gtk2=yes
44
45make %{?_smp_mflags}
46
47%install
48rm -rf $RPM_BUILD_ROOT
49make install DESTDIR=$RPM_BUILD_ROOT
50
51pushd $RPM_BUILD_ROOT%{_datadir}/xgreeters/
52        ln -s lightdm-gtk-greeter.desktop lightdm-greeter.desktop
53popd
54
55find $RPM_BUILD_ROOT -name '*.a' -delete
56find $RPM_BUILD_ROOT -name '*.la' -delete
57
58%find_lang %{name}-greeter
59
60
61%post -p /sbin/ldconfig
62
63%postun -p /sbin/ldconfig
64
65
66%files -f %{name}-greeter.lang
67%defattr(-, root, root, -)
68%doc AUTHORS COPYING ChangeLog NEWS README
69%{_sysconfdir}/lightdm/lightdm-gtk-greeter.conf
70%{_sbindir}/lightdm-gtk-greeter
71%{_docdir}/lightdm-gtk-greeter/sample-lightdm-gtk-greeter.css
72%{_datadir}/icons/hicolor/scalable/places/*
73%{_datadir}/xgreeters/lightdm-greeter.desktop
74%{_datadir}/xgreeters/lightdm-gtk-greeter.desktop
75
76
77%changelog
78* Sat May 09 2015 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.8.5-3
79- add Requires: gnome-icon-theme, gtk2-engines
80
81* Sun Aug 24 2014 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.8.5-2
82- add Patch1002 (lightdm-gtk-greeter-1.8.5-background.patch)
83
84* Sun Jun 01 2014 Yoji TOYODA <bsyamato@sea.plala.or.jp> 1.8.5-1
85- initial build
86
Note: See TracBrowser for help on using the repository browser.